The government will buy the Steam Packet Company.
Tynwald debated the issue this afternoon, which saw Treasury Minister Alf Cannan present the proposed deal to members.
The motion passed with the majority of members voting in favour, only Douglas South MHK Kate Beecroft voted against the purchase.
The move is expected to cost £124 million.
